Yet Another Nintendo Bundle


Nintendo
Nintendo recently announced that they are  creating a limited edition Gamecube and bundle in honor of Squenix's Final Fantasy Crystal Chronicles.  But this is not the only bundle that they have in store for a Squenix game though.  Nintendo plans on releasing a special addition Gameboy Advance in honor Sword of Mana, the upcoming remake of Final Fantasy Adventure.

Similar to the FF:CC bundle, it is unknown as of yet whether this bundle will see a North American or PAL release.

FF:CC to Trigger Special Edition NGC in JP


General Final Fantasy
It's abbreviation MADNESS, I tell you. MADNESS.

Nintendo is putting some major backing into the return of Square to their consoles after a nearly ten-year absence. According to the Japanese game magazine V-Jump, by way of Magic Box, Nintendo of Japan intends to release a limited-edition NGC set with a "Crystal White" 'Cube and controller, a GBA Player, memory card, and, of course, FF:CC.

No word yet on whether this will come to US shores - in fact, it's still not official in that country with the red dot flag, but GAF has a picture of the set.

Super Mario Advance 4 Screens


Games_Are_Fun has posted some new screenshots of Super Mario Advance 4. SMA4 is a port of the classic Super Mario Bros. 3 to the Gameboy Advance.  

The game will be a port of the version that was on the Super Mario All-Stars game on the Super Nintendo, not the original NES one.  It is scheduled for release in Japan on July 11th.  It will not see North American shores until late September though.
